Input streams lost their timeout. The problem appears to be {{DFSClient#newConnectedPeer}} does not set the read timeout. During a temporary network interruption the server will close the socket, unbeknownst to the client host, which blocks on a read forever. The results are dire. Services such as the RM, JHS, NMs, oozie servers, etc all need to be restarted to recover - unless you want to wait many hours for the tcp stack keepalive to detect the broken socket.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.3.4#6332)
